Community West Bancshares is the issuer of Common Stock, no par value, CUSIP 203937107. An amended Schedule 13G filing by Fourthstone LLC and affiliated entities reports beneficial ownership of the company’s common stock. Fourthstone, acting as a registered investment adviser, directly holds 100 shares of Common Stock on behalf of advisory clients. The reporting group, including Fourthstone Master Opportunity Fund Ltd., Fourthstone QP Opportunity Fund LP, Fourthstone Small-Cap Financials Fund LP, Fourthstone GP LLC, and L. Phillip Stone IV, collectively reports 0.00% of the outstanding class, based on 27,134,206 shares outstanding as of May 7, 2026. The reporting persons state that the securities were acquired and are held in the ordinary course of business and not for the purpose or effect of changing or influencing control of Community West Bancshares.

Beneficially own means having the economic rights and risks of a security—such as the right to receive dividends, sell the shares, or profit from price changes—whether or not your name appears on the official share register. Think of it like renting a car: you use it and reap the benefits even if the title lists someone else. Investors care because beneficial ownership determines who truly controls value, must be disclosed under securities rules, and can signal potential influence or trading activity that affects a stock’s price.

Shared voting power occurs when two or more parties jointly have the right to vote or decide how a block of company shares is cast, like co-owners who must agree before moving a piece of furniture. Investors care because who controls voting rights affects board elections, major corporate decisions and takeover outcomes, and shared control can alter regulatory disclosures and the practical influence any holder has over a company’s direction and value.

A registered investment adviser (RIA) is a firm or individual legally registered with regulators to give personalized investment advice and manage clients' money, with a duty to put clients’ interests ahead of their own. Think of an RIA as a licensed financial guide who must disclose fees, conflicts and how they are paid; that transparency and legal duty matter to investors because it reduces the risk of hidden costs or biased recommendations.

A Schedule 13G is a formal document that investors file with the government when they acquire a large ownership stake in a company, usually for investment purposes rather than control. It helps keep the public informed about who owns significant parts of a company's shares, which can influence how the company is managed and how investors make decisions. Filing this schedule is important for transparency and understanding the ownership landscape of publicly traded companies.
